Yes they are labeled, but to be honest you could poitn and i could tell you what it does.

The valves are color coded for that purpose, yellow is the return lines from the sump to tank. Black are the drains into the sump. And only red valves are on the closed loop.


"How are you going to water proof the outlets?" not sure I follow you?
 
You can get weather covers at Lowes or HD. I have GFCI outlets behind my tank as you do and they need to have the salt creep and moisture dried off of them all the time.
